Easy example of connotation and annotation

English
1 answer:
Sidana [21]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Connotation is the use of a word to suggest a different association than its literal meaning, which is known as denotation. For example, blue is a color, but it is also a word used to describe a feeling of sadness, as in: “She's feeling blue.” Connotations can be either positive, negative, or neutral.

Reader Annotations

A student noting important ideas from the content by highlighting or underlining passages in their textbook.

A student noting examples or quotes in the margins of a textbook.

A reader noting content to be revisited at a later time.

A Bible reader noting sources in their Bible of relevant verses for study.
